Transaction 166421593b2e1e7ddc26f791fe76e85dc6376193595a13e79dcb852bb993b1d4
1 Input
1 Output
-
166421593b2e1e7ddc26f791fe76e85dc6376193595a13e79dcb852bb993b1d4:0
- value
- 234593
- script pubkey
- OP_0 OP_PUSHBYTES_20 7bf7a2d5750b23a47a65ef0a50603ec4a99ead9c
- address
- bc1q00m694t4pv36g7n9au99qcp7cj5eatvu3e25yx